is my mac dying?

hi,


i have a iMAC 27 (half 2010).For the second time in a row as i open up the computer on the screen i see b&w square full of grain that cover half of it. It last few seconds than everything is ok.It make me think that the screen could crash soon.am i sadly right? 2 questions for you:

1) can i do anything right now to prevent the final event before it's too late?

2) in case no,can it be repaired at a reasonable cost or i have to buy a new one?.

Back up everything of importance, now. Do the Apple Hardware Test

on your machine (Using Apple Hardware Test - Apple Support).

.....

2) in case no,can it be repaired at a reasonable cost or i have to buy a new one?.

.....

It all really depends on what the issue is. May have something to do with the logic board

or could be the display itself. You could make a few calls and get estimates of either scenario.

Then, only you can decide which is a more worthwhile expenditure, repair or new. Repair costs

can vary widely depending on location. Strongly suggest you get the work done by an

Apple authorized repair service.
